New Dual Enrollment Students

  1. Select the college you plan to attend for dual enrollment (most common: WCC, LCC, or Cleary).

  2. Apply directly through the college’s website:

  3. Send your high school transcript by creating a Parchment.com account (link and directions linked here).

  4. College-specific requirements:

    • WCC: Obtain and complete WCC’s Dual Enrollment Packet (linked here).

    • LCC: The dual enrollment process is completed online.

    • Cleary: Print Cleary University forms and return the completed application to the Counseling Office.

  5. Obtain the Dual Enrollment Packet from the Counseling Office or the PCHS website and return it to the Counseling Office after you are registered for classes.

    **Please note: Per the State of Michigan, dual enrollment courses must not be offered at PCHS or must be unavailable due to an unavoidable scheduling conflict (MDE). Additionally, students are not allowed per the State of MI, to take courses in physical education, theology, divinity, religious education, hobbies, crafts, or recreational courses.

If you have questions regarding the transferability of courses, please contact the college you are dual enrolling with directly or visit this website for more information. The PCHS Counseling Office is not able to determine whether a course will transfer or not.

To view courses that are part of the Michigan Transfer Agreement (MTA), please visit this link. It is the responsibility of the student and their family to research transfer equivalencies between colleges.
